Set within the sought after village of Great Ryburgh, Willow Cottage is the perfect retreat for guests seeking somewhere beautiful in which to relax after a busy day out and about. With all fittings brand new in 2018, this property adjoins the owner’s holiday home (which is rarely used) and has been furnished and decorated to provide everything needed for the perfect stay, including a wood burner for those cosy evenings in.
Great Ryburgh has its own fish and chip shop as well as a butchers, and lies close to the stunning North Norfolk coastline. You can travel to Wells-next-the-Sea in just 20 minutes, where you will find an unspoilt and much photographed quay, a wide sandy beach, a single gauge railway that almost delivers you right to the sand. There is also a great mix of traditional seaside shops and boutiques, and lots of great places to eat and drink. If you can tear yourself away, you can head east or west from here to discover pretty coastal towns and villages with a host of different coastal habitats including sand and shingle beaches, marshes and quays. Head east and explore Cromer with its famous pier and Edwardian seafront, or west and discover all the fun of the fair at Hunstanton. Make sure to stop off at all the pretty seaside villages and towns in between.
Closer to home lies Pensthorpe Natural Park, Norfolk’s biggest tourist attraction, which is home to a variety of wildlife and offers garden trails in a sprawling countryside lake and woodland conservation park. The Thursford Collection, with its much celebrated Thursford Christmas Spectacular is also nearby. Travel just a little further and explore the Norfolk Broads, either on a day launch or on an organised tour. Or, for a change of pace, head into the medieval city of Norwich with its splendid Norman Castle and numerous museums, galleries and attractions. Add in National Trust sites and stately homes such as The Blickling Estate and Holkham Hall and you will see that there really is something for everyone in this part of Norfolk. Fakenham is just 4 miles away with four supermarkets, cinema, flea market and an auction on Thursdays. Golf is available locally and there is horse racing at Pudding Norton, near Fakenham.
